In this week’s Japan Weekly Kickstart, we focus on 2Q CY2026 performance trends.

TOPIX gained +14% qoq, while Nikkei gained +37% qoq (its best ever quarterly

performance). The top three best-performing TOPIX 17 sectors in 2Q were three of

our five sector OWs: Electric Appliance & Precision (+48% qoq), Steel and

Non-Ferrous Metals (+26% qoq), and Banks (+23% qoq). The worst-performing

sectors in 2Q were Energy (-23% qoq), Commercial & Wholesale Trade (-11% qoq)

and Electric Power & Gas (-10% qoq). The AI and BOJ normalization themes

continued to lead the market higher in 2Q. In contrast, resource-related themes

pulled back after strong performance in March driven by geopolitical concerns

focused on the Middle East. On a year-to-date basis, both TOPIX (+19% ytd) and

Nikkei (+38% ytd) are outperforming the S&P 500 (+9% ytd), which in turn continues

to have a positive impact on the net foreign flows (see below).
